Very disappointing. Three of us went for a pre-concert early meal. One of us was French, from the food capital of France, and we were so ashamed to have taken her to Gio's. First, they got the order wrong for one of us. Secondly - unimaginative undercooked vegetables accompanied a piece of sea bass drowned in a reddish coloured sauce of unidentifiable flavour. Thirdly, we ordered dessert for one of us and coffee for three. The coffee arrived, but no dessert. We had to ask twice what had happened to it before it eventually arrived, long after we had drunk our coffee. We were met with uncomprehending looks when we enquired about it. And before even the coffees arrived we were presented with a bill, probably somebody else's. Service was, to say the least, confused, sometimes sullen. I got the impression that the servers' English could not cope . Needless to say, we will not be going there again

We booked our table in advance and when we arrived at the restaurant it was almost full, which was reassuring as it was our first time eating out in Manchester. Staff were friendly and attentive, we were served promptly and food arrived fresh and hot. Our starters of chicken wings and garlic and tomato bruschetta was delicious. Our mains of pollo a la crema were very generous portions with fresh steamed veg were very tasty. We had ice cream a little later for dessert this wasn't rushed and we thoroughly enjoyed it. The staff were chatty and wished us well as we left. I would absolutely recommend Gio's, it was a relaxed and inviting atmosphere and we felt very welcome there. We will definitely return if we are back in Manchester again.
